Namie Amuro – New album PVs “ONLY YOU”, “In The Spotlight (TOKYO)”, “Let’s Go”

Better late than never! Here are three promotional videos from Namie Amuro‘s new album Uncontrolled.

 

First up is ONLY YOU. Download it here.

What a beautiful music video! The scenery is breathtaking and perfect for summer. Of course, Namie is the gem of this PV. She looks fantastic in that dress.

ONLY YOU sounds amazing. It’s an all English song, and surprisingly, her English pronunciation is perfect! It feels like I’m flying when I listen to this. I love the beat and her singing is like a lullaby. ONLY YOU is definitely one of her best works to date. I’d say it’s good enough to be played on the radio here.

 

Next is In The Spotlight (TOKYO). Download it here.

This seems more like it in terms of Namie’s style and image as the Queen of Hip-pop. It’s very mainstream but there’s something to be said of the quality and direction.

In The Spotlight (TOKYO) is another all English song, but I didn’t find this one to be as smooth. I can understand everything she’s saying, which is good, but the pronunciation this time isn’t quite there. The lyrics border on lame, but overall I think Namie did a great job pulling off this kind of song.

 

Lastly, we have Let’s Go. Download it here.

Damn Namie…HOT DAMN. She turns it on in this music video. Other than that its pretty straightforward. I stared at her perfect bod most of the time XD.

Let’s Go sounds like a filler track. It’s kind of short and I don’t find anything special about it, besides the suggestive lyrics.

Namie Amuro – “Love Story” PV

Here’s the PV for Namie Amuro‘s “Love Story”. The track appears as an A-side on her recently released single “Sit! Stay! Wait! Down! / Love Story“. The video can be downloaded here, but there may be some annoying ads XD.

This actually aired way back in the beginning of December and I totally missed it on Jpopsuki -_-. There’s not too much to say about the PV; it has a very natural feeling to it. It reminds me of Baby Don’t Cry‘s PV with Amuro walking and singing. She’s such an exotic and beautiful woman ;).

The song is amazing @_@. I wasn’t expecting anything bad, but this totally blew me away! I always forget how great her voice is; it has so much substance behind it. The chorus is powerful because of this and hits you hard.

“Love Story” is an excellent winter ballad. I don’t know how the other A-side is, but I’ll most likely get it for this song alone!
